Taking to Instagram on Sunday, Eniola Badmus shared a video of herself wearing her celestial gown, dancing happily in the white garment.
However, the video didn’t sit well with some of her fans, given the current hardship in the country.
Several followers accused her of celebrating while people suffer under a government she endorsed.
One follower, Chinonso Reymond, insulted her in the comments, saying, “Oloriburuku human being. Why you no go dance? Aunty Ode. E no go better for you and Tinubu.”
Eniola responded by calling him a jobless being and suggesting he should leave the earth because it’s full: “Jobless human being. Earth is full, go home.”
Another fan told her to enjoy life because karma would catch up with her: “Enjoy the life cause you will get all you deserve in fold. Na una dey spoil country.”
Eniola replied, suggesting they check Jumia for a life for sale: “Why not check Jumia, I think they have a life for sale.”
KanyiDaily recalls that Eniola Badmus recently got a political appointment from the Speaker of the House of Representatives of Nigeria, Tajudeen Abbas.
